3.2 Intended use
The Dräger X-act 7000 is used to determine gaseous compounds in the
ambient air. Depending on the Dräger MicroTubes used, the device measures
the smallest of concentrations of the corresponding substance, predominantly
in the ppb range.
For sensor measurements, a system of sensors and hoses (graphic C/3)
measuring up to 45 meters in length may be connected to the device using the
coupler (graphic C/1) and the X-am pump (graphic C/2).

Intended field of application and conditions of use, hazard areas
according to zones
The device has been designed for use in the potentially explosive atmospheres
of zones 0, 1 and 2, in compliance with the temperature range as specified on
the device, and in which gases of explosion groups IIA, IIB or IIC and
temperature class T4 can occur.
The list of applied standards can be found in a copy of the EU-type examination
certificate and the IECEx Certificate of Conformity or in the EU Declaration of
Conformity.
If the device is used in off-shore applications, a distance of at least 5 m to any
compasses must be maintained.

4.1 Batteries
The display consumes the most energy. For this reason, the display lighting
will switch off after 30 seconds. The lighting is switched on again by pressing
any key.
The lighting will also switch on again for 30 seconds as soon as a measurement
has been completed.
WARNING
Explosion hazard!
The use of non-approved batteries may cause explosive and combustible
atmospheres to ignite. The intrinsic safety of the device can be endangered.
Only use the batteries listed in the following chapter, otherwise the approval
will expire.
Carefully read and follow the description below.
WARNING
Explosion hazard!
The batteries in the device may explode if exposed to intense heat or force.
Do not throw the device into a fire, keep it away from any sources of heat
and do not try to open it forcefully.
Only change batteries outside of explosion-hazard areas.
NOTICE
Damage to the device caused by battery acid
Leaking battery acid can damage the device.
Remove the batteries if the device has not been used for more than 6
months.
Only insert undamaged batteries into the device.
